Current technologies allow sampling indoor air on a continuous real-time basis to allow measurement of viral loads in air duct systems of complex buildings. Quite similar to wastewater testing that can also be applied to complex buildings.
We could/should be exploring air surveillance as a natural counterpart to wastewater surveillance. Environmental pathogen burden is a great surrogate for risk and gets around both logistic challenges and issues of representativeness that accompany testing individual people
